FAQ-1177 Wie definiere ich eine Konstante, die mit den Eingabedaten in einer Anpassungsfunktion in Verbindung steht?

Letztes Update: 06.06.2023

Wenn Ihre benutzerdefinierte Anpassungsfunktion eine Konstante hat, die mit den Eingabedaten in Verbindung steht, können Sie sie als einen Parameter definieren und mit der Anfangsformel festlegen.

Beispielsweise können Sie die folgende Funktion definieren:

y = y_min + (y_max-y_min)*exp(-k*x)

wobei k der zu berechnende Parameter ist und y_max und y_min die Konstanten sind, die mit den Eingabedaten verbunden sind - y_max ist das Maximum des Y-Datensatzes und y_min ist das Minimum.

Um die Konstanten y_max und y_min in Origin zu definieren:

  1. Definieren Sie im Dialog Fitfunktionen erstellen > Seite Variablen und Parameter k, y_max und y_min als Parameter.
    User Define Constant FAQ 1177 1.png
  2. Legen Sie auf der Seite Parameterinitialisierungscode die Initialisierungsformel für y_max und y_min fest, indem Sie auf die dreieckige Schaltfläche klicken und die gewünschte Formel in der Ausklappliste auswählen.
  3. Aktivieren Sie Initialisierung der festen Parameter zulassen, um y_max und y_min auf ihre Anfangswerte festzulegen.
    User Define Constant FAQ 1177 2.png

Schlüsselwörter:benutzerdefinierte Funktion, Anfangswert, nichtlinearer Kurvenfit, Konstante, Metadaten